Suttons Bay: Business Helper. Near Fine. 2009. First Edition. Softcover. SIGNED by the author and dated 2009. "...a veteran newspaperman's recollections (good & bad), and a few laughs, in words and photos." Dick Kerr was a Leelanau County, Michigan journalist for many years with the Leelanau Enterprise, and before that the Ypsilanti Press. He grew up in Ann Arbor and attended HIllsdale Collge. His lifetime recollections aare recorded here, and are often humorous.
